Does diffuse esophageal spasm progress to achalasia? A prospective cohort study.

Sayed Saeid Khatami1, Farah Khandwala, Steven S Shay

  • 1Department of Gastroenterology and Hepatology, Center for Swallowing and Esophageal Disorders, Cleveland Clinic Foundation, Ohio 44195, USA.

Digestive Diseases and Sciences
|September 1, 2005
PubMed
Summary

Progression from diffuse esophageal spasm (DES) to achalasia is uncommon. Some DES patients with low esophageal amplitude may develop increased contractions, potentially indicating a manometric shift over time.

Background:

  • Diffuse esophageal spasm (DES) and achalasia share clinical and manometric features.
  • Previous reports suggest DES may progress to achalasia, but prospective data are lacking.

Purpose of the Study:

  • To prospectively evaluate the rate of manometric progression from DES to achalasia.
  • To identify potential predictors of this manometric progression.

Main Methods:

  • Retrospective review of manometry tracings from patients diagnosed with DES between 1992-2003.
  • Prospective follow-up manometry was performed on a cohort of eligible DES patients.
  • Independent, blinded interpretation of initial and follow-up manometry by two esophageal experts.

Main Results:

  • One of twelve (8%) DES patients progressed to achalasia on follow-up manometry.
  • Seven patients (58%) maintained DES manometric findings; three (25%) normalized; one (8%) developed nutcracker esophagus.
  • No initial manometric parameters predicted progression to achalasia.
  • A subgroup with low baseline esophageal body amplitude showed increased simultaneous contractions over time.

Conclusions:

  • Progression from DES to achalasia is an uncommon event.
  • DES patients with low esophageal body amplitude may exhibit evolving manometric patterns, including increased simultaneous contractions.
  • Diffuse esophageal spasm remains a challenging diagnosis both clinically and manometrically.
